KALAMAZOO (WWJ) – A young woman has died after being hit by a car early Saturday morning near the campus of Western Michigan University.
The Kalamazoo Department of Public Safety announced that 21-year-old Kaylee Gansberg of Lisle, Illinois, was hit around 2:30 a.m. Saturday near W. Michigan Avenue and Howard Street.
Gansberg, who was a student at WMU, died later Saturday, according to a report from WOOD TV in Grand Rapids.
Officials said the driver involved in the crash had taken off, but was found a short time later.
The driver’s name has not been released, but was identified as a 22-year-old Kalamazoo resident. It was not clear if they were a student at the university.
Police determined the driver had been under the influence of alcohol at the time of the crash and the driver was arrested on related charges.
